What is a TSB number?
Technical Service Bulletins are issued by manufacturers when there is a problem found in a number of cars which does not have an obvious fix. The TSB is a guide for mechanics to fix the problem but it is not a free fix by itself.
How do I find TSBs?
How to Find Free TSBs. To find a TSB, go to NTHSA’s Safety Issues & Recalls page. Type in either your vehicle’s unique 17-character vehicle identification number or its year, make, and model. The site will display recalls, investigations, and complaints.
What is the difference between a recall and a TSB?
Sometimes a TSB is confused with a recall. The main difference is that a recall is issued by a vehicle manufacturer for issues that are safety-related, while a TSB covers components that may be malfunctioning but don’t compromise the safety of the vehicle.

What is a TSB on a vehicle?
Defining Technical Service Bulletin A recall is a government-mandated action that requires automakers to repair a safety-related defect for free. But a TSB comes from the manufacturer to address a common defect — unrelated to safety — in a particular vehicle. TSB repairs aren’t necessarily done for free.
What is Toyota TSB?
A Technical Service Bulletin (TSB) is a communication between Toyota and its dealerships that can serve as an update to Toyota publications, describe parts updates, or relay enhanced or new service procedures.
